Systematic, synthetic phonics for early reading success by Julia Donaldson.
Delightful phonics stories by best-selling author of
The Gruffalo
, combined with interactive whiteboard software to deliver the requirements for high quality phonics teaching.
Features
Systematic, synthetic approach with pace
Delightful decodable stories for focused phonic practise
Fully compatible with a broad and rich curriculum
Multi-sensory approach through interactive software
Blending and segmenting activities to reinforce reading - writing link as a reversible process
Strong focus on Speaking and Listening skills
Opportunities for assessment
Clear, structured progression for learning all grapheme-phoneme correspondences
Levelled to Oxford Reading Tree Stages and Book Band levels for easy classroom management
